We thoroughly enjoyed our stay at the "Royal Glitter Bay Villas " in Barbados. From the moment we stepped on the property we knew it was going to be nothing short of amazing. We were met by a Fabulous lady " Nuru" who took us straight to the bar upon our arrival and we were served the most refreshing Rum Punch drink which is well known to the Islanders... She took us through the complex for a tour ,had our bags delivered to our rooms and made us feel like Royalty. What a beginning..
The Beach was Pristine. The first few days the red flag was up and I was dying to jump into the sparkling waters free of Seaweed... The flag turned to yellow and you couldn't keep me out of the water! It was simply Divine.The staff are the Best, they treat everyone with a high degree of respect. Whether you were looking for directions or an opinion on where to go for fun...anything, they are at your beck & call. We can even say that we thoroughly enjoyed the occasional seller coming to our lounger. They were extremely interesting and respectful of your time. You can get anything from the most amazing massage using a real Aloe Vera plant to shopping for local art and Jewellery.
The condo itself is Spic and Span and nicely decorated with a wonderful balcony overlooking the pool and some with ocean views. You can walk the beaches
both ways and meet up with amazing people from all over the world.
We spent our time soaking in the sun ,reading a book, walking along the beach . Sometimes we ate at the bar on the site and the food was very good. We really enjoyed the first night when you get to meet everyone that is staying at the condo , great conversations, food & drinks... some people had guitars and we had some sing alongs too. You will enjoy seeing monkeys on the premises and an occasional cat or two.
Once you leave the condo you can grab a cab, hop on a bus or even walk to certain places. We felt very safe. We both actually enjoyed hopping on the bus and meeting the local people who made sure we got off in the right place or told us about great places to eat and things to do.There is a market close buy and you can experience Barbados Grocery shopping. Some things on the shelf's you may never see again, that's for sure!
